项目管理的神圣模型有哪些
-
项目管理的神圣模型可以分为以下几种:
-
瀑布模型(Waterfall Model)
瀑布模型是最早被广泛采用的项目管理模型之一。它将项目分为一系列线性的阶段,如需求定义、设计、开发、测试、实施和维护。每个阶段都是有序且依次进行的,且每个阶段的结果都是固定并无法改变的。 -
敏捷模型(Agile Model)
敏捷模型是一种迭代和增量的项目管理方法。它强调团队合作、灵活性和适应性,在整个项目周期中快速响应变化。敏捷模型的核心原则是通过不断迭代的开发周期,在不同阶段及时反馈和调整。 -
螺旋模型(Spiral Model)
螺旋模型集成了瀑布模型和敏捷模型的优点,强调风险管理。在项目周期中,团队通过迭代的方式进行需求分析、风险评估和原型开发,每个迭代结束后进行评估和调整。 -
V模型(V-Model)
V模型是一种与测试密切相关的项目管理模型。它将项目的开发和测试工作进行了并行和对称的方式,开发阶段与测试阶段呈“V”字型的递进关系。通过对照开发和测试的需求、设计、编码和验证,可以提高产品的可靠性和质量。 -
脚手架模型(Scrum Model)
脚手架模型是敏捷开发方法中的一种。它注重团队合作、沟通和自组织,并通过短周期的迭代(称为sprints)来进行开发。团队通过每个迭代的计划、执行、回顾和调整,逐步推进项目的开发并提高产品的质量。
以上是常见的几种项目管理的神圣模型。根据项目的特点、需求和团队的情况,可以选择适合的模型进行管理和实施。
1年前 -
-
项目管理的神圣模型主要有以下几种:
-
瀑布模型(Waterfall Model):瀑布模型是项目管理中最传统的模型之一,也是最常用的模型之一。它以线性顺序来完成项目的各个阶段,包括需求分析、设计、开发、测试和发布。每个阶段都必须在上一个阶段完成后才能开始,且不允许出现重返或并行流程。这种模型适用于项目需求稳定、技术成熟且风险可控的情况。
-
敏捷模型(Agile Model):敏捷模型是近年来兴起的一种项目管理方法。它以迭代循环的方式进行项目开发,每个迭代周期一般为几周到几个月,通过每个周期的反馈和调整来不断改进产品。敏捷模型强调快速响应变化、高度合作和自组织团队,适用于需求不稳定、迭代开发和创新型项目。
-
增量模型(Incremental Model):增量模型是一种将项目拆分成多个相互依赖的增量阶段进行开发的方法。每个增量阶段都是一个可独立完成、具有独立功能的产品版本,随着每个增量的完成,产品逐渐完善。增量模型适用于需求较为明确但规模较大的项目,可以降低项目风险并快速交付部分功能。
-
螺旋模型(Spiral Model):螺旋模型是一种以风险管理为核心的项目管理方法。它将项目开发分为多个循环迭代的阶段,并在每个阶段进行风险评估和控制,根据评估结果决定下一步的行动。螺旋模型可以很好地应对需求不确定或技术风险较高的项目。
-
女巫帽模型(Witch Hat Model):女巫帽模型是一种将项目划分为多个子项目并同时进行的管理方法。每个子项目都有清晰的目标和范围,并有相应的资源和团队进行管理。女巫帽模型适用于大型复杂项目,可以通过并行管理不同的子项目来提高效率和可控性。
总体而言,这些神圣模型各自有其适用的场景和优势,项目管理者可以根据项目特点和要求选择最合适的模型进行管理。
1年前 -
-
在项目管理领域中,有几个被认为是“神圣模型”的方法或框架,它们被广泛采用,帮助项目经理和团队有效地规划、执行和交付项目。以下是几个目前被视为项目管理神圣模型的方法:
-
PMBOK(项目管理知识体系)
PMBOK是世界上最广泛使用的项目管理方法。由美国项目管理协会(PMI)发布并更新。PMBOK将项目管理划分为十个知识领域,包括项目整合管理、范围管理、时间管理、成本管理、质量管理、人力资源管理、沟通管理、风险管理、采购管理和相关方管理。对于每个领域,PMBOK提供了一套最佳实践和方法论。 -
PRINCE2(项目管理国际经验精要)
PRINCE2是一种基于过程的项目管理方法,源于英国政府的项目管理最佳实践。PRINCE2将项目管理分为七个原则(如明确项目目标和角色职责)和七个主题(如商业论证和变更控制)。PRINCE2强调项目阶段划分、管理阶段目标和阶段评审。 -
敏捷方法(如Scrum、看板和精益方法)
敏捷方法的目标是通过迭代、增量和自组织的方式进行项目管理,以适应快速变化的需求。Scrum是一种广泛使用的敏捷方法,强调团队协作、划分工作为短期迭代周期和通过日常“站立会议”进行沟通。看板方法(如看板,看板和看板)跟踪项目进展以及待办事项。 -
女巫模型(权衡约束模型)
女巫模型(也称为“三角形”)是在项目管理中常用的一个模型,表示在项目中三个主要约束之间的权衡和平衡(也称为“约束”):范围、时间和成本。女巫模型表明,这三个约束之间的变化关系,如果其中一个约束发生变化,其他约束可能会受到影响。 -
风险管理
风险管理是一种系统的方法,用于识别、评估和处理项目中的风险。这个方法着重于预测潜在的问题和风险,并采取相应措施以降低风险发生的可能性和影响。常用的工具和技术包括风险登记册、风险评估矩阵和风险管理计划。 -
项目管理软件
项目管理软件是一种组织和跟踪项目进度、资源和时间的工具。常用的项目管理软件包括Microsoft Project、Trello和Asana等。这些工具提供了项目计划、任务分配、进度跟踪和团队协作等功能。
这些方法和模型相互补充,可以根据项目的具体情况和需求选择合适的方法和工具进行使用。
1年前 -